Saudi Arabia can meet its growing power needs solely through the deployment of new solar projects with energy storage, Ibrahim Babelli, deputy minister, Ministry of Economy and Planning of Saudi Arabia, said at the MENASol 2016 conference held recently

MAN Diesel & Turbo has received an EPC-contract to build a 40MW oil fired power plant for the Arabian Cement Company (ACC) in Saudi Arabia

Oman Power and Water Procurement Company (OPWP) has awarded a consortium consisting of Mitsui & Co, ACWA Power and Dhofar International Development and Investment Holding Company (DIDIC) the 3,219MW Ibri Sohar-3 power generation project
